SUGAR BOWL
The first resort in Lake Tahoe, Sugar Bowl Resort has a prime spot that was picked by Walt Disney himself. It’s right on Donner Summit, which receives more snow than almost anywhere else in North America, so its webcam is a great one to check for snow conditions or sunny mountain views.
Tahoe Vista Recreation Area
Part of the Lake Tahoe Water Trail, this lakeshore recreation area offers an interpretive visitors’ plaza, picnic tables, restrooms, boat launch, seasonal kayak rentals and more. Watch the weather and water conditions to plan your trip.
Interactive Kayak Cam
Explore the waters of Lake Tahoe virtually with this interactive kayak camera tour provided by the Tahoe Fund and EarthViews, the first-ever “Street View” style map of all 72 miles of Lake Tahoe’s shoreline.
